Apple to run user-created iPod touch ad

updated 11:10 am EDT, Fri October 26, 2007

Home-brewed iPod touch ad

Apple is preparing to air a new TV commercial on Sunday, October 28th featuring its recently introduced iPod touch. The commercial features a fast-paced overview of the portable player atop a song titled "Music Is My Hot, Hot Sex," according to the New York Times. Interestingly the spot's creator, Nick Haley, is an 18-year-old student and Apple fan in the UK who created the content and uploaded his video to YouTube. There the ad received four out of five stars as well as numerous positive comments, and YouTube revealed more than 2,100 views of the home-brewed advertisement as of Thursday, October 25th.



Haley said he found inspiration for the ad in one particular lyric: "My music is where I'd like you to touch." Basing his visual effects on iPod touch video clips and other new product introductions viewable at Apple.com, the student said he was contacted by TBWA/Chiat/Day, a long-time Apple agency, about creating a professional version of the spot.

"I was sitting on the bus and I got this e-mail on my phone," Haley explained.

"We represent Apple and we've seen what you have produced and we'd like a chat with you," the message read.

Haley recalled that "This seemed ridiculous and far-fetched. My initial reaction was, someone wanted to steal it."

After his realization that the message was indeed legitimate, Haley traveled to Los Angeles to begin work on a broadcast-quality version of his home made advertisement alongside executives at TBWA/Chiat/Day.
